我正在使用icanhaz.js模板,我想知道是否有人知道是否可以为模板创建的列表中的每个<li>指定一个类名?
例如:
<script id="testLI" type="text/html">
<li class="list-1">
<p>Name: {{ name }}</p>
<p>Here Now: {{ count }}</p>
<p>ID: {{ id }}</p>
</li>
</script>如果我可以让每个<li>都有一个类'list-1','list-2','list-3',等等。
发布于 2013-02-12 05:17:12
不确定您是如何实现的。但是你应该循环你的数据,并且在你的循环中有一个计数器。每次在{{index}}中增加计数器。
<script id="testLI" type="text/html">
<li class="list-{{index}}">
<p>Name: {{ name }}</p>
<p>Here Now: {{ count }}</p>
<p>ID: {{ id }}</p>
</li>
</script>示例循环
for (var i = 1; i < data_var.length; i++) {
var data = {
index: i,
name: "name",
count: "count",
id: "id"
}
// Do whatever you need with data.
// html = ich.listLI(data)
}https://stackoverflow.com/questions/14820745
复制相似问题